The sum of 6 and 3 divided by the difference of 6 minus 3

The sum of 6 and 3: 6+3

The difference of 6 minus 3: 6-3

The sum of 6 and 3 divided by the difference of 6 minus 3: [tex]\frac{6+3}{6-3}[/tex][tex]=\frac{9}{3}=3[/tex]
